On October 31, 2013, Henan Zhongyuan Four Seasons Aquatic Product Logistics Port officially began operations after attracting investment and undergoing extensive construction—built on the foundation of the original Zhengzhou Aquatic Products World. Today, it stands as a major market in China's central and western regions, seamlessly integrating the trading and processing of aquatic products and livestock commodities. It also serves as a large-scale cold-chain, warehousing, and logistics hub for the entire region. Henan Zhongyuan Aquatic Product Logistics Port Supports the Belt and Road Initiative
The Zhongyuan Aquatic Products Logistics Port has signed a special research collaboration agreement with the "Belt and Road" Cultural Exchange and Economic Development Research Group. Together, the two parties will engage in joint research, academic discussions, expert consultations, and other collaborative activities centered around the "Belt and Road" initiative and the specific project of the Henan Zhongyuan Aquatic Products Logistics Port.
The "Henan Zhongyuan Aquatic Products Logistics Port" project has been officially included in the dynamic "Belt and Road" Project Database, which currently features a selection of influential and highly impactful projects and initiatives across China that are driving the broader "Belt and Road" development agenda.
During his visit to the Zhongyuan Aquatic Products Logistics Port, Li Guoqiang, a researcher at the Development Research Center of the State Council and Honorary Director of the Guosheng Think Tank, noted that the company’s growth is closely aligned with the "Belt and Road" initiative. He emphasized that, amid the national implementation of the "Belt and Road" strategy, the external environment has provided robust support for the company’s expansion—while its strategic direction remains fully in sync with government policies.
Li Guoqiang expressed confidence that, by leveraging its position within the "Belt and Road" framework, the Zhongyuan Aquatic Products Logistics Port is poised to achieve strong momentum and sustained growth in the years ahead.
